Does the male mourning dove leave the nest after female lay their eggs?

A Mourning Dove pair rarely leaves its eggs unattended. The male usually incubates from midmorning until late afternoon, and the female sits the rest of the day and night.

How long before mourning doves eggs hatch?

Mourning dove eggs typically take about 14 to 15 days to hatch after being laid. The incubation is primarily carried out by both parents, who take turns keeping the eggs warm. Once hatched, the chicks are altricial, meaning they are born helpless and rely on their parents for food and care.
